OpenBSD 4.1’s spamd(8) now includes default support for trapping SMTP clients using an envelope to: not listed in /etc/mail/spamd.alloweddomains. If you only accept mail for example.com and example.org, put them in spamd.alloweddomains, and mail to: all other domains (relay attempts) are rejected and the host trapped. Clean and effective.
